## Bounce Processor: Stuck Queue Recovery

When Mailhawk's bounce processor stalls, first confirm the ingest daemon on the Kestrelport cluster is still consuming from the bounce topic. Do not restart the classifier blindly; in-flight soft bounces will be reclassified as hard and suppress valid recipients. Instead, drain the retry shelf, verify suppression counts against yesterday's baseline, then restart workers one at a time. Record the deploy you restarted against, using the token below.

session token of fahop-tawig = htk3_da3

## Deploying the Gatewick Proctor Queue

Deploys are pretty painless: push to main, wait for the pipeline, then watch the queue drain dashboard for five minutes. If candidates pile up mid-exam, roll back first and ask questions later — the queue replays safely. Everything the workers care about lives in one config block, shown here for reference.

settings of bafof-yagef:
JOROX_PIN=8740
JOROX_TENANT=pelox
JOROX_METRICS_HOST=metrics.jorox.qorvelworks.internal
JOROX_SEAL=seal_c78f63c1
JOROX_STANDBY_TEAM=norax

### Step 6 — Timezone handling in exports

Reporta exports previously stamped rows in server-local time, which leaked the deployment region. This step switches all export timestamps to UTC with an explicit offset column. Verify no stored procedure still calls the local-time helper; the linter flags remaining uses. Audit logs are unaffected. Confirm the export worker is restarted with the configuration below.

config for tajof-kawep:
[aldius]
port = 3000
region = lower-2
host = aldius.plorvasoft.example
team = eliius
timeout_ms = 750
retries = 6

## Authentication

Heads up: the nightly reindex job (`reindex_nightly.py`) talks to the Lanternfish search cluster, and that cluster won't accept anonymous writes anymore — we locked it down last sprint. The job now authenticates as the `reindex-runner` service identity against Corvid Gateway, and the token is injected via the `LF_INDEX_TOKEN` env var in the scheduler config. Nothing clever going on, just a bearer header on every batch request. For review purposes, the staging credential currently in use is listed below.

service key, kadug-kadup: kto15_rN23XLAYImmZgrJ